Belt - ?

This belt is very unusual. Made out of high silver in a very accurate way. The blue stones are lapis lazuli. Due to the manufacture technique of the belt, it is stretchable, which is quite incredible. It was definitely a very skilled silver smith manufacturing this piece as the joints, etc. are very accurate and smooth.Does anybody know the provenance of this belt? (I bought it as Persian...).   • I feel it is a kind of a modernist . art deco (?) style made somewhere in Europe but it totally fits persian coloring standards with those lovely lapis lazuli cabs!

  • Beautiful belt! I also feel it is most likely an art deco period piece rather than "ethnic", but it is very attractive all the same. The way the stones are set reminds me of Southern German/Austro-Hungarian folk jewellery. What I really like is the woven part!
